How to access CBSE 12th Result?

CBSE has provided different online and offline means by which candidates can access class 12th result as per their convenience. The different mode for accessing result are shared below-

  • SMS

Type following text-

Cbse12 <rollno> <sch no> <centre no> and send it to mobile no. 7738299899

Once the result will be delivered successfully candidates will get their result on their mobile phones in the form of SMS.

  • IVRS

Under this facility, candidates will receive their result through an IVRS (Integrated Voice Response System). They just have dial a number of NIC (National Informatics Centre) issued by the CBSE to access the result. The IVRS nos are given below-

  • Digilocker

Digilocker (https://digilocker.gov.in) is another internet platform to access class 12th CBSE result. This facility was started in 2016 and since then it is being used as a platform to share CBSE result with the students enrolled.

Like previous years, students can also view their CBSE class 12th 2020 result. This application can be used in both mobile and PC/Laptops. Mobile application of Digilocker is available for both Android and IOS users is available. To check the result on mobile, users have to download the application and have to register.

Board will send the Digilocker account credentials to students through SMS on their registered mobile nos.

  • Official websites of respective schools

Students can also visit their respective school to know their result as all the schools affiliated to CBSE get entire school’s result on their email ID’s already registered with the Board.

  • Google Search Engine

Students can also view their result directly on the Google search engine i.e. www.google.co.in.

  • Result on Microsoft Search Engine



Just like Google, candidates can also access class 12th result on Microsoft Search Engine (https://www.bing.com). They also use SMS Organizer App on mobile and it can be downloaded from play store (https://aka.ms/sms).

  • Umang App

Just like Digilocker, candidates can also use UMANG app to view their result.

Particulars mentioned on CBSE Class 12th Result

Candidates who will access their result online will find given information on their result sheets-

  • Name of the students  
  • Roll no. of the students
  • Mode of exam (Regular/Private)
  • Date of birth
  • Mother’s name
  • Father’s name
  • Name of school (for regular students)
  • Subject name and subject code
  • Marks in theory
  • Marks in practical/ internal Assessment
  • Total marks obtained
  • Maximum marks
  • Result status (Pass/ Fail/ Compartment)

Information in the online result sheet or mark sheet accept the marks and result of the students, will be mentioned as per the information furnished in the registration form by the candidates. In case of any discrepancy in the particulars, candidates are advised to contact respective school department or Board.

CBSE 12th Compartment Exam

Like Board conduct compartment exams after the declaration class 10th result it also conducts compartment exams after class 12th result announcement. Candidates who will not be able to manage to pass the exam are given a second chance to pass the year. These candidates have to pass the particular paper in which they have got compartment. In case candidates fails to pass the compartment exam then he/she has to repeat the class and an entire year will be wasted.



So, candidates who will get compartment need not to get disheartened, they just have to prepare more for the another chance. The complete notification about the compartment exams will be published later after the result by the board on its website. Compartment exams are conducted in the month of July and by the end of August 2020, students receive their result.

CBSE Class 12th Mark Sheet 2020

The result published on the official websites is just for the purpose of information to the students. They should not treat it as the original mark sheet. Original statement of marks of the candidates will be issued later by the Board. Candidates have to collect their original mark sheet from school concerned.  

School falling under the Delhi region are advised collect their result from the office of the respective Zonal Office of the Deputy Director of Education after the publication of result. Before visiting the office, they need to confirm the time with them.
